The Department of Social Development has in the current financial year set aside a budget of R19 million for the management and smooth operation of the Seshego Treatment Centre.
This is according to MEC Nkakareng Rakgoale when delivering her department’s budget vote speech in the Legislative chamber on Friday. She said the centre was officially opened on 23 October last year and started with admissions in November. Thus far, 47 service users were admitted to the facility and 33 discharged having completed rehabilitation programmes for a period of three months, she explained.
Rakgoale further highlighted that the department was committed to provide office accommodation to social workers and community development practitioners in deep rural areas to bring services closer to the people. She pointed out projects that were completed and officially opened in May as Mankweng and Gawula offices, adding that the Mookgophong offices would be completed in September while the ones in Saselemani are expected to be finished by March next year. An additional five office accommodation projects would commence in October this year in Dzumeri, Tshilwavhusiku, Bela-Bela, Moutse and Mecklenburg, Rakgoale stated.
